A cellular basis for the mammalian nocturnal-diurnal switch
Early mammals were nocturnal while dinosaurs dominated the daytime. Mammalian transition to daytime activity accelerated after the Cretaceous-Paleogene extinction, but the underlying mechanisms remain...

Artistic representation of the complex dynamics exhibited by “clock proteins” within the brain.
Uncovering the hidden complexity behind the brain’s master clock.
New research led by @nsmyllie.bsky.social, in Michael Hastings’s group, reveals that body clock proteins PER2 & CRY1 act more independently than previously thought:
